The Supreme Court ruled on an appeal concerning a tenant's right to remove an adjoining wall of a property owned by the appellant. The court upheld the Bombay High Court's decision allowing the tenant to proceed with the removal, provided it did not damage the appellant's property. The judgment emphasized the balance between a tenant's rights and a property owner's interests in maintaining the integrity of their property.
